RGLS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

83 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Regulus Therapeutics (RGLS)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$86.9M — up 10% from $78.9M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in RGLS was balanced in Q3 2016: 12 funds opened new positions, 12 closed out, 21 added to existing stakes and 26 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Renaissance Technologies, opening a new position worth an estimated $2.21M. The largest seller was Numeric Investors, cutting an estimated $1.83M.
